Step 1: Assessing the Situation
Our technicians arrive on-site, equipped with moisture meters, to assess the extent of the damage and identify the source of the water. We’ll find out the best course of action to extract the water and dry the flooring quickly and efficiently.
Step 2: Extracting the Water
We’ll use heavy-duty pumps and vacuums to extract the water from your laminate flooring, reducing damage and preventing further warping. Our technicians will also use specialized equipment to detect hidden water and ensure that all moisture is removed.
Step 3: Drying the Flooring
We’ll apply drying protocols to your laminate flooring, using advanced equipment to speed up the drying process and prevent further damage. Our technicians will also monitor moisture levels to ensure that your flooring is dry and ready for use.
Step 4: Restoring Your Property
Once the water has been extracted and the flooring has been dried, our technicians will assess the area to find out if any further repairs are needed. We’ll work with you to restore your property to its original condition including any necessary repairs or replacements.

Laminate Floor Water Extraction Cost In Hermosa Beach, CA
Estimates for Laminate Floor Water Extraction in Hermosa Beach, CA vary based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and other local conditions. Prices can range from $500 to $2,500 or more, depending on the extent of the work required.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$1,500 | Severity of the damage and the size of the affected area |
| Professional equipment rental | $100 – $500 | The type and quality of the equipment used |
| Moisture meter readings | $50 – $200 | The number of readings taken and the complexity of the assessment |
| Containment and cleanup | $200 – $1,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of materials used for containment |
| Reinstallation of laminate flooring | $1,000 – $3,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of materials used for reinstallation |
| More repairs or replacements | $500 – $2,000 | The extent of the damage and the type of repairs or replacements required |

Q: How can I prevent water damage to my laminate flooring?
A: To prevent water damage to your laminate flooring, ensure that your home is equipped with a reliable plumbing system, and inspect your pipes regularly for signs of leaks or damage.
